graph each transformation, and rewrite the algebraic rule in words. 3. rule: (x,y)→(x,y - 5) describe the transformation in words: 4. rule: (x,y)→(x + 1,y + 4) describe the transformation in words: write a description and a rule for each of the translations shown. the original pre - image is shown in gray, and the new image is shown in white. 5. description: rule: 6. description: rule:
Step1: Analyze rule (x,y)→(x,y - 5)
The x - coordinate remains the same and the y - coordinate is decreased by 5. So the transformation is a vertical translation 5 units down.
Step2: Analyze rule (x,y)→(x + 1,y + 4)
The x - coordinate is increased by 1 and the y - coordinate is increased by 4. So the transformation is a translation 1 unit to the right and 4 units up.
